Output 8dd59babad3768b7f108af6bc6efc65665eb71ba8706bffcc9fa34b06d5e838b:1

value
4392418
script pubkey
OP_0 OP_PUSHBYTES_20 25156321dcfab3b003af1239241f889530fd9850
address
ltc1qy52kxgwul2emqqa0zgujg8ugj5c0mxzsxe8yeg
transaction
8dd59babad3768b7f108af6bc6efc65665eb71ba8706bffcc9fa34b06d5e838b
spent
true